简要总结

Mask ventilation is pivotal during general anaesthesia (GA) especially at induction, serving as the primary means of ventilation before securing a definitive airway. It encompasses two critical aspects: ensuring an airtight seal between the mask and the patient’s face to prevent gas leakage and maintaining an unobstructed upper airway. Despite this, patients are prone to airway obstruction. Using the 2-hand technique of mask ventilation and / or use of airway adjuncts such as oropharyngeal or nasopharyngeal airway might help relieve this obstruction.

Nasal mask ventilation directs inspired air through the nasal cavity, countering gravity’s influence on the soft palate and tongue, thereby maintaining upper airway patency. Consequently, direct nasal ventilation may offer improved ventilation efficacy and a more natural breathing pattern. Contin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P), delivered via non-invasive ventilation masks not only prevent upper airway collapse but also are being used in the ICUs to ventilate patients and also pre-oxygenate before intubating the critically ill. Literature also suggests using the Rendell Becker Soucek mask and even paediatric facemasks can be used for nasal ventilation in children and edentulous patients but these do not provide positive airway pressure (PAP) and neither are specifically designed to give a perfect fit. Super NO2VATM is specifically designed for nasal ventilation and also has the advantage of providing positive pressure ventilation that would maintain patency of upper airway. This novel device has been introduced in the market for its use in obese patients with obstructive sleep apnoea who are posted for procedures under sedation. In this study, we are using this device for mask-ventilating patients at the start of general anaesthesia and trying to compare its effectiveness with that of the Conventional Facemask technique of ventilation
